The Bell Curve

878
The normal probability distribution, often depicted as a symmetrical, bell-shaped curve, is fundamental in statistics and the study of natural phenomena. This pattern, famously described by mathematician Carl Friedrich Gauss, shows how data points are distributed around a central mean, with most values near the average and fewer observations occurring as they deviate further from it.

What is Natural Selection?

129.5K
Natural selection is an evolutionary process in which individuals with survival-promoting traits reproduce at higher rates. These favorable traits become more common within a population or species. Naturally selected traits initially arise via random genetic mutations. In order for selection to occur, there must be variation within a population, the trait controlling the variation must be heritable, and there must be an evolutionary advantage for variation in the trait.

Nature and Nurture

22.4K
Many human characteristics, like height, are shaped by both nature—in other words, by our genes—and by nurture, or our environment. For example, chronic stress during childhood inhibits the production of growth hormones and consequently reduces bone growth and height. Chirality in Nature

17.3K
Chirality is the most intriguing yet essential facet of nature, governing life’s biochemical processes and precision. It can be observed from a snail shell pattern in a macroscopic world to an amino acid, the minutest building block of life. Most of the snails around the world have right-coiled shells because of the intrinsic chirality in their genes. All the amino acids present in the human body exist in an enantiomerically pure state, except for glycine - the sole achiral amino acid.

The Wave Nature of Light

61.5K
The nature of light has been a subject of inquiry since antiquity. In the seventeenth century, Isaac Newton performed experiments with lenses and prisms and was able to demonstrate that white light consists of the individual colors of the rainbow combined together. Newton explained his optics findings in terms of a "corpuscular" view of light, in which light was composed of streams of extremely tiny particles traveling at high speeds according to Newton's laws of motion.

Charles Bell (1774-1842) and Natural Theology.

Sean Hughes1, Christopher Gardner-Thorpe2

  • 1Department of Surgery and Cancer, Imperial College, London, UK.

Journal of Medical Biography
|September 1, 2018
PubMed
Summary

Sir Charles Bell and William Paley believed the human body

Area of Science:

  • Medical History
  • History of Science
  • Theology

Background:

  • 19th-century surgeon and anatomist Sir Charles Bell was influenced by Natural Theology.
  • William Paley's 18th-century work established Natural Theology as proof of an Intelligent Designer.
  • Bell utilized his artistic talents in anatomy and surgery education.

Discussion:

  • Bell's anatomical illustrations and writings, including the Bridgewater Treatises, reflected Natural Theology principles.
  • He illustrated Paley's "Natural Theology," emphasizing design in the animal frame and human structure.
  • This paper explores the alignment between Bell's and Paley's views on creation and design.

Key Insights:

  • Bell and Paley shared a harmonious belief in a divinely created world.
